| Arkansas Blue Cross and Blue Shield offers two Medicare Advantage private fee-for-service plans:
Medi-Pak® Advantage MA and Medi-Pak® Advantage MA-PD. A Medicare
Advantage Private Fee-For-Service plan works differently than a Medicare supplement
plan. The doctor or hospital must agree to accept the plan’s terms and conditions
prior to providing healthcare services, with the exception of emergencies. If the
doctor or hospital does not agree to accept our payment terms and conditions, they
may not provide healthcare services, except in emergencies. Providers can find the
plan’s terms and conditions below. |

Out-of-state Medicare Advantage Private Fee-for-Service Plans
If you provide health-care services to a member of another Blue Plan’s Medicare Advantage private fee-for-service
(PFFS) plan, you do so under that Blue Plan’s Terms and Conditions. Medicare Advantage PFFS Terms and Conditions
may vary for each Blue Cross and/or Blue Shield plan, and we advise you to review the Terms and Conditions before
providing services to Medicare Advantage PFFS plan members from out of state.
